廣州Java培訓(xùn)好不好?Java入門基礎(chǔ)知識(shí)點(diǎn)匯總,下面和千鋒廣州小編一起來看看吧。
一、靜態(tài)方式和屬性
靜態(tài)方法和屬性用于描述某一類對(duì)象群體的特征,而不是單個(gè)對(duì)象的特征。Java中大量應(yīng)用了靜態(tài)方法和屬性。但這種技巧在很多語言中不被頻繁地使用。理解靜態(tài)方法和屬性對(duì)于理解類與對(duì)象的關(guān)系是十分有幫助的,在大量的Java規(guī)范中,靜態(tài)方法和屬性被頻繁使用。因此學(xué)習(xí)者應(yīng)該理解靜態(tài)方法和屬性。Java在方法和屬性的調(diào)用上是一致的,區(qū)別只表現(xiàn)在聲明的時(shí)候和c++不同。
二、接口
在面向?qū)ο笤缙诘膽?yīng)用中大量使用了類繼承,用聚合代替繼承。軟件工程解決擴(kuò)展性的重要原則就是抽象描述,直接使用的工具就是接口。接口近年來逐漸成為Java編程方法的核心。另一方面,就應(yīng)用而言,大部分開發(fā)是建立在規(guī)范基礎(chǔ)之上的,不需要自己建立復(fù)雜的繼承關(guān)系和龐大的類。讀懂規(guī)范和用好規(guī)范已經(jīng)成為應(yīng)用程序開發(fā)人員的首要任務(wù),Java各項(xiàng)規(guī)范的主要描述手段就是接口。
三、集合框架
Java描述復(fù)雜數(shù)據(jù)結(jié)構(gòu)的主要方式是集合框架。Java沒有指針,而是通過強(qiáng)大的集合框架描述數(shù)組、對(duì)象數(shù)組等復(fù)雜的數(shù)據(jù)結(jié)構(gòu)。學(xué)好這些數(shù)據(jù)結(jié)構(gòu)的描述方法對(duì)于應(yīng)用程序編寫,特別是涉及到服務(wù)器、三層結(jié)構(gòu)編程至關(guān)重要。程序員在這個(gè)時(shí)候不能再用諸如數(shù)據(jù)庫(kù)結(jié)果集之類的結(jié)構(gòu)描述數(shù)據(jù)了。由于很多語言沒有這么強(qiáng)大的集合框架體系,很多初學(xué)者不知所措,更不知道拿來做什么用應(yīng)該引起足夠的重視。
如果你對(duì)Java開發(fā)感興趣,可以來千鋒廣州校區(qū)免費(fèi)試聽,開啟你的編程之旅。
2022-04-13 廣州千鋒教育發(fā)布了 《如何甄別廣州Java培訓(xùn)機(jī)構(gòu)哪一家比較好?》的文章
2021-11-22 廣州千鋒教育發(fā)布了 《廣州HTML5開發(fā)培訓(xùn)哪家靠譜?前端職責(zé)是什么?》的文章
2021-11-22 廣州千鋒教育發(fā)布了 《廣州學(xué)Java好找工作嗎?自學(xué)和培訓(xùn)的區(qū)別在哪?》的文章
2021-11-22 廣州千鋒教育發(fā)布了 《如何選擇好廣州Web前端培訓(xùn)機(jī)構(gòu)?給你3點(diǎn)建議》的文章
2021-11-19 廣州千鋒教育發(fā)布了 《廣州Java學(xué)習(xí):沒有基礎(chǔ)該如何學(xué)習(xí)Java?》的文章